It's a strategy that's not to be totally condemned. It has it's advantages & disadvantages. Also, hat's what works in Nigeria, especially South West. I sell goods online. There are times we ll put price on products n it ll lead to another competitor to lessen theirs.
Marketing has various tools & if you really want to succeed (especially in a saturated online marketing), you v to be savvy.
From my own survey, dm me for price hasn't reduced my customer ratio.
The following are reasons why they do so
1. To conceal prices from competitors (fellow online vendors): How ll you feel when you discover people are selling faster/better than you cos they reduced their price than yours cos they saw yours online.

2. To be able to maintain a bargaining rate of choice: Some goods don't v fixed prices. I can choose to sell N2500 for someone & N3000 for another client. There's no sin in that.

3. To prevent negotiating fixed prices. Some believe they can negotiate anything.

These are some few points I v.
Lastly, this is Nigeria. What works here may not be ideal in other places.
If you want to survive with your online business, be savvy. Keep prices that you feel you should keep & reveal those to be revealed!
When you see dm for price, some May v genuine reasons. Dm them if you like what they are selling.
